spy-debugger
spy-debugger copied to clipboard
开启spy-debugger后页面打不开
开启spy-debugger后,打开命令行提示的地址,一直显示加载中。 命令行报mime.lookup is not a function
@bing1021 ,是用cnpm安装的?如果是可以先删掉spy-debugger再用npm重装下试试 参考这个看看:https://github.com/wuchangming/spy-debugger/issues/55#issuecomment-330146335
用的cnpm,我在试试
解决了,用npm安装就可以了
@bing1021 ,手机是否有安装证书?什么手机型号,浏览器类型是?
手机都安装了证书,浏览器 60.0.3112.113。iphone6可以用的,4s不行 @wuchangming
@bing1021 ,可以看看抓包的页面是否有记录到请求, 手机上是否开启了翻墙软件之类的?需要先关闭。
spy-debugger\[email protected]@connect\lib\middleware\static.js 中require"mime" 由于connect依赖没有限定版本号,所以cnmp下载的是mime2.0,但mime2.0变api了。 spy-debugger\[email protected]@connect\node_modules\mime\README.md(如果是mine2.0版本)中提到
-
lookup()
renamed togetType()
-
charset()
andload()
methods have been removed 所以将static.js里的lookup()改成getType(),将变量charset = 'utf8'直接附成字符串。这样就不会有mime的报错了。 用cnpm安装Weinre的话也有这个问题。稍微改一下就ok。
cnpm 安装报错问题已在V3.6.8版本修复
iphone 6s plus调试只能抓包,看不到页面,targets 为none
iphone 5s 调试只能抓包,看不到页面,targets为none 另外百度页面打不开